The legal system executes numerous essential roles within modern society.

Due to the different legal cases resolved all over the globe, there are several types of courts employed today. Among the most frequently utilised courts today would be civil courts. Basically, these courts are used to manage legal cases which do not include criminal offences. These courts manage different cases including family matters, contract disputes and personal injury claims. In civil courts, the burden of proof is typically lower than it is in criminal courts. The plaintiff must offer a greater weight of proof to indicate that a crime or injustice was committed by another individual or company. Those that are familiar with the Italy court system would certainly state that criminal courts manage cases featuring criminal charges and are developed to establish whether the accused is guilty of the charges brought against them. These courts address a wide array of severe offenses including misdemeanours, felonies and traffic offences. If an individual is found guilty, sentences and fines are possible outcomes.

Within the contemporary day, the government executes a variety of various roles in society. Within each government, there are generally three various branches. Although they all carry out an essential role, it is important to take a look at just how the judicial branch promotes justice and stability worldwide. Professionals within this branch interpret the law and ensure legal cases are dealt with properly within courts. The importance of courts is highlighted through their capability to offer a space for individuals and companies to seek justice. Courts are developed to supervise every legal case impartially and ensure everyone can have a fair trial. As seen within the Malta court system, courts copyright the rule of law. Essentially this means the law will certainly be consistently applied to every person, despite their standing. This ensures that order is kept in society and legal proceedings can highlight the shortfalls within the pre-existing legal system. When the law can not be utilised to fairly handle a case, it highlights the need to alter laws or develop brand new ones.
